About this service

Also known as a jackshaft opener, this unit mounts to the wall beside your garage door instead of the ceiling. You need this if you have high ceilings, need extra storage space above the door, or simply want a quieter operation. These systems are more specialized than traditional openers, so the cost typically reflects the specific mounting requirements and the power needed for your door. How are garage door rollers replaced in Milwaukee?

Replacing garage door rollers in Milwaukee typically involves lifting the door slightly to relieve tension. The old rollers are then removed from the tracks. New, properly sized rollers are installed, ensuring they slide smoothly. The technician will check for proper alignment and lubrication. This restores quiet operation.
